7199 / Mayoral Messages/Announcements
The Mayor expressed his thanks to all involved in the Santa Parade:Switch-on of lights and Carols event which had been very successful .
7200 / To receive duly notified questions from the Public
Mrs Melanie Evans attended and addressed the Council in relation to clarification of her original letter in relation to the Town Council moving its Offices to Salem from the Welfare Hall..
The Mayor indicated that the matter was not up for debate and allowed comments on the subject matter of Mrs.Evans’ address
Responses were received as follows:
Cllr R.JHancock OBE responded as to the contractual nature of the matter rather than personal or political as implied by Mrs Evans
Cllr J. Butcher stated that he felt it was the right decision for the Town Council to move its Offices but he was not happy with the matter of dis-association of the Town Council with the Welfare Hall
The Mayor thanked Mrs Evans for her attendance and Mrs Evans responded by stating that she hoped that the situation could be improved / re-considered in the future bearing in mind what is good for the Community.

7205 / To consider the Town Clerk’s General report
The Town Clerk presented his general report.
Friends of Salem
AGM was held on 14th November 2016 and all Officers were re-appointed.
The Lease was still to be signed and signatures thereto were being arranged.
There was now a situation that had arisen on Monday 12th December 2016 whereby there was concern as to the access rights of the owners of Salem Villa and Salem Manse. This issue was being discussed with the Solicitor to the Presbytery and depending on his response/action thereto could have a material effect on the Lease to both the Friends of Salem and subsequently to the Town Council.
It was RESOLVED to note the position.
Quarterly Meeting with BCBC
The Town Clerk referred to the fact that progress was hoped to be made on the CAT transfers requested by the Town Council as there was now a replacement CAT Officer in BCBC.
It was RESOLVED to note the position.
Internal Dispute Resolution
The Town Clerk stated that he had been informed by Cllr A. Williams that the matter had been resolved.
It was RESOLVED to note the position.
Bridgend and Ogwr Food Bank
The Town Clerk reported that there was a need to promote the Foodbank as take-up had been marginal. He stated that the Offices at Salem would be a collectionpoint for donations. The Mayor indicated that he would be circulating more information regarding the Foodbank. Further collection points to be considered
It was RESOLVED to note the position.
Office accommodation update.
The Town Clerk reported that albeit his report indicated that the communications issue had been resolved he was now experiencing problems..
It was RESOLVED to note the position.
